My favorite episode would have to be the one where the "Zack Attack" was brought on the scene. I love the way they made that episode. Seeing Casey Casum, someone I, as a DJ, really admire, was cool too. Did you know that there is a "Saved By The Bell" Soundtrack? It has about 5 of the songs performed on that episode.
